Several dealerships within the dataset experienced dramatic traffic spikes tied to promotional events, social campaigns, or short-term paid media surges. In isolation, these spikes appear positive. In context, they often represent volatility rather than durable growth.
Insight:
High-volume traffic without corresponding engagement indicates attention without capture. These moments generate noise rather than demand.
Bot and non-human traffic were identified in a significant portion of the sample. In several cases, more than 25 percent of visits originated from regions with no plausible commercial relevance.
The “Click Farm” Effect: Programmatic display campaigns running on low-quality networks were found to be driving traffic with 100% bounce rates and 0.0-second session durations.
Insight:
Phantom traffic inflates performance reporting while degrading retargeting efficiency. Many dealers are unknowingly optimizing campaigns against corrupted datasets.
